Pros:

  1. Innovative Design: With the Flyknit upper and the Air unit running the entire length of the shoe, Nike has delivered a highly innovative and visually striking design.
  2. Weightless Comfort: The Air unit promises superior cushioning and an unparalleled “walking on air” experience, while the Flyknit upper provides breathability and support. This combination seems poised to deliver an impressive level of comfort.
  3. Eco-Friendly: With at least 20% of the Flyknit upper made from recycled content, these shoes align with sustainability efforts and an environmentally conscious lifestyle.
  4. Versatile Style: Available in an array of colors, these shoes can easily complement different outfits and personal styles.

Cons:

  1. Price Point: Retailing at $210, these shoes may not fit into everyone's budget. For some, the high price tag could be a significant deterrent.
  2. Potential Durability Issues: While it's hard to say without personal wear-and-tear experience, the Air unit, despite its comfort, might be more prone to punctures or damage over time compared to traditional soles.
  3. Limited Traction: The rubber outsole design might not provide enough traction for more demanding activities or slippery conditions, making these shoes potentially less versatile for outdoor adventures.
  4. Traditional Lacing System: For some, a traditional lacing system might be seen as a drawback, especially given the shoe's high-tech design and price point. Other fastening options, such as a quick lace or slip-on design, might have added convenience for users.
